Jobs for Prepress/Desktop Publishing Grads in California
In this state, there are 2,640 people employed in jobs related to a Prepress/Desktop Publishing degree, compared to 27,070 nationwide.
Wages for Prepress/Desktop Publishing Jobs in California
Prepress/Desktop Publishing grads earn an average of $57,010 in the state and $50,773 nationwide.
